Virus Delete?

I found a program that I had bought at Staples about a year ago. It's ONTRACK FixIT Utilities. It has a virus scanner that works with WIN95.
I went to their website and downloaded the latest DAT files for viruses. It found a virus in my Windows system ( msrv32.exe.) I tried deleting the file after all attempts to clean the virus with the virus program failed. It will not allow me to delete this application program which seems to be a vital component of the WIN95 System.
Got any ideas how to get rid of this file, since I can't get rid of the virus?

It probably won't let you delete it because it's in use by Windows. Boot into DOS mode & you should be able to delete it.
